Heater Component Location Overview






Heater Component Location Overview

Disconnect the battery before removing components marked with a **.





1 Dash Panel **

2 Center Vents

Removing vents, refer to => [ Front Center Vents ] Front Center Vents.

3 Air Duct To Right Side Vent

4 Passenger Vent

Removing vents, refer to => [ Driver and Front Passenger Side Vents ] Driver and Front Passenger Side Vents.

5 Fresh Air and Heated Air Controls

With fresh air/recirculating door switch (E159).

Removing controls, refer to => [ Display and Control Unit ] Display and Control Unit.

On vehicles with heated seats also with heated driver seat adjuster (E94) and heated front passenger seat adjuster (E95).

6 Fresh/Recirculating Air Door Motor (V154)

Removing, refer to => [ Fresh/Recirculated Air Door Motor V154 ] Fresh/Recirculated Air Door Motor V154.

7 Right Footwell Vent

Removing and installing, refer to => [ Front Passenger Footwell Right Vent ] Front Passenger Footwell Right Vent.

8 Fresh Air Blower (V2)

Removing, refer to => [ Fresh Air Blower V2 ] Service and Repair.

9 Fresh Air Blower Series Resistor With Fuse (N24)

Removing and installing, refer to => [ Fresh Air Blower Series Resistor with Fuse N24 ] Service and Repair.

10 Heating Unit Partition

11 Dust and Pollen Filter

With or without an activated charcoal filter element

Different versions depending on the vehicle version and equipment level. Refer to Electronic Parts Catalog (ETKA).

Follow the replacement intervals. Refer to => Maintenance Procedures.

Removing and installing, refer to => [ Dust and Pollen Filter ] Service and Repair.

12 Cap

Only in vehicles without air duct to vent installed in center console at rear.

13 Connection

For air duct, rear vent

It is necessary to first remove the center console in order to remove the connection.

14 Rear Vent Air Duct

15 Rear Vent

16 Right Footwell Rear Channel

Removing and installing, refer to => [ Rear Channel, Footwell ] Rear Channel, Footwell.

17 Left Footwell Rear Channel

Removing and installing, refer to => [ Rear Channel, Footwell ] Rear Channel, Footwell.

18 Screw

Quantity: 8

19 Adapter for Controls

20 Heater Core

Change the coolant after replacing the heater core.

Removing and installing, refer to => [ Heater Core ] Heater Core.

21 Left Footwell Vent

Removing and installing, refer to => [ Driver Footwell Vent ] Driver Footwell Vent.

22 Auxiliary Heater Heating Element (Z35)

Not applicable to the US or Canada

23 Temperature Door Cable

Removing and installing, refer to => [ Temperature Door Release Cable ] Temperature Door Release Cable.

24 Flexible Shaft

Removing and installing, refer to => [ Flexible Air Distribution Shaft ] Flexible Air Distribution Shaft.

25 Heater

Removing and installing, refer to => [ Heater ] Heater.

Disassembling and assembling, refer to => [ Heater, Disassembling and Assembling ] Heater, Disassembling and Assembling.
